AO51 CXG is a 2001 Kawasaki ZRX1200S in Silver with a 1,165c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2001 Kawasaki ZRX1200S models, the average MOT pass rate is 87.1% with a typical mileage of 20,664 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kawasaki ZRX1200S f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 52 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AO51 CXG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kawasaki ZRX1200S typ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 25 years old, this Kawasaki ZRX1200S is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
